When to Use Caution
No single asset is a silver bullet. There are situations where the Beautiful Cristal Christmas Tree may not be the right fit. It should be used carefully in formal corporate branding where the tone needs to be strictly utilitarian or serious. It is also less effective in dense information layouts where every pixel is dedicated to data or instructions. Avoid using it on low-contrast backgrounds, as the delicate crystal details may get lost. Furthermore, if your brand is extremely minimal or industrial, this ornate illustration might clash with your existing aesthetic. Finally, be mindful of text-heavy ads; if the text competes with the tree for attention, the message will fail to communicate clearly.
Practical Notes for Designers and Marketers
Before integrating this asset into your final campaigns, follow these practical steps to ensure success:
- Test with Your Palette: Ensure the colors in the illustration harmonize with your brand color palette. Adjust hues if necessary to match your specific brand identity.
- Check Black and White Usage: Preview the design in grayscale to check for contrast issues. This is crucial for print materials like packaging design or stickers.
- Mockup Testing: Place the illustration inside real campaign mockups. See how it behaves when resized for mobile screens or printed on small product labels.
- Font Pairing: Experiment with typography. The elegance of the tree pairs well with serif fonts for a classic look, sans serif fonts for a modern feel, and script fonts for a personal touch. Avoid handwritten fonts that might reduce readability.
- Review Spacing: Pay close attention to negative space. Allow the illustration to breathe so it does not feel cramped against other elements.
- Verify Licensing: Always confirm the commercial license before using the asset in paid campaigns, client work, or business branding. Understanding the terms of use protects your business legally.
